Re: is vegetable shortening legal " Is vegetable shortening Ok made from pine oil ? " I have never heard of pine oil. I think the most common subsitute for butter is coconut oil. It tends to be " wetter " . So, use just 3/4 of the called-for amount. 1 cup butter = 3/4 cup coconut oil Coconut oil is a semi-solid opaque oil that is purchased in jar resembling mayonnaise jars.
